Synthesis,Crystal Structure and Magnetic Property of the 2D Mn(Ⅱ) Coordination Polymer Based on 4,4'-Bisimidazolylbiphenyl and m-Phthalic Acid[J]. A 2D complex {[Mn(4,4'-bibp)(MPA)]·4H2O}n (1), based on mixed-ligands bibp (bibp=4,4'-bisimidazol-ylbiphenyl) and H2MPA (H2MPA=m-phthalic acid), has been synthesized by hydrothermal method and charac-terized by elemental analysis, IRspectra, XRD, TGA, and the crystal structure was determined by single-crystal X-ray diffraction. The complex crystallizes in the triclinic system, space group Pl, and features 2Dbilayer structure. Magnetic susceptibility measurement of complex 1 indicates the presence of weak antiferromagnetic interactions between the neighboring Mn(Ⅱ) ions. CCDC: 928642.
